Subject: Payroll export cut-over complete

Cut-over to the new Ferrowell payroll export format finished last night. Old fixed-width files are gone; everything now emits the v2 delimited format. Downstream parsers at Brindlemoor HR confirmed clean ingestion this morning. One retry on the first batch, nothing since. Rollback window closes Friday. For the release record, the exporter is now running with the following settings.

config for fahag-kawif:
ulaok:
  pin: 9623
  tenant: noveth
  seal: seal_4c98895f
  metrics_host: metrics.ulaok.zarqeldata.internal
  standby_team: wenwyn
  escalation: lamix-kelion
  nonce: f4ce43

Action item from the Mirewater tide-table widget incident. Owner: release manager. Widget cached stale harbor offsets after the DST change, showing tides six hours off for two days. Required: add a cache-invalidation check to the release checklist, block deploys when offset tables are older than 24 hours, and verify the Saltgate harbor feed before each cut. Deadline: next release. Checklist template and sign-off procedure are documented on the internal page below.

wiki page, kawif-bajep: https://artifactory.zarqelforge.internal/issue/browse/display/display/projects/spaces/secrets/000fe6ec5a46af29355003e1

**Ticket: Drift in order-cutoff rule — Crumbline POS**

The evening order-cutoff for the Harrowgate bakery sites was changed manually on two store terminals last week and never synced back to the fleet template. As a result, three locations accept online orders forty minutes past kitchen close. Please treat the template as canonical and repush to all terminals in the next release window. The values that should be in effect fleet-wide are listed here.

settings of tagef-bawif:
DRUIX_HOST=druix.zemvarlabs.internal
DRUIX_PORT=8000